Hey — handing over the ParcelPing webhook before I'm off to the Brindlewood office. Quick notes for newcomers: the webhook listens for carrier scans from Swifthaul and retries three times with backoff. If Swifthaul sends duplicate scan events (they do, constantly), the dedupe cache in Larkfield Redis handles it. Don't touch the signature check; Priya rewrote it last sprint and it's solid. If the whole pipeline wedges, you'll need the vault to restart the signer. The recovery passphrase for that vault is below.

unlock words, yawig-kagef: gordor-holvan-ulaael-pramir-ulaiel-tamdor

## Configuration

Flagwright reads rollout rules from `flagwright.toml` at boot. Percentages, cohorts, and kill switches live there; edit and redeploy, no restart needed. Release managers own the `rollouts` block — engineering owns everything else. Stage changes go through the Driftvale staging cluster first, always. Audit logging is on by default and cannot be disabled in prod. The control-plane API requires a signing secret, loaded from the environment file. Add the following line to `.env.production`:

env line for yahag-kajog: VAULT_KEY13=e1c568d90102d

**Ticket: Tax-rate cache connection failures**

Plugin authors are reporting intermittent timeouts when the Ledgerpine tax-rate lookup cache falls back to the source database. The cache itself is healthy; failures occur only on cold keys during the fallback query. We bumped the pool size without effect. To reproduce against the shared staging instance, point your plugin's fallback client at the connection string below.

primary connection of tawif-yajeg = postgresql://rusiel_svc:G879q9cx6GsSvj@db-dd9f.norvagrid.internal:5432/casath

This alert fires when cold-start latency for Lanternfly serverless handlers exceeds the two-second budget over a five-minute window. Plugin authors should note that cold starts affect your handler's first invocation after idle periods, and heavy initialization in plugin entry points is the most common cause. Trim module-level imports and defer expensive setup where possible. Tuning guidance, current warm-pool settings, and the exemption request process are described on the internal page below.

operations page: https://vault.qorvelcorp.example/settings